Django 5.0

Par:
fredericmazue

jeu, 07/12/2023 - 14:12

Django est un framework de développement web en Python. Il a pour but de rendre le développement web 2.0 simple et rapide (comme tous les frameworks de développement web ;-) Le slogan du projet Django est 'Le framework pour les perfectionnistes avec des deadlines'. Django vient de sortir en version 5.0

Il s'agit d'une version majeure du framework, qui, selon les reponsables du projet, contient, un déluge de nouvelle fonctuionnalités intéressantes. Les points fort le splus notables, toujours selon les responsables du projet, sont :

  • Les valeurs par défaut calculées par la base de données permettent de définir des valeurs par défaut pour modéliser les champs.
  • Poursuivant la tendance à l'expansion de Django ORM, le champ de modèle généré permet la création de colonnes générées par la base de données.
  • Le concept de groupe de champs a été ajouté au système de modèles pour simplifier le rendu des champs de formulaire .

Django 5.0 prend en charge Python 3.10, 3.11 et 3.12. La série Django 4.2.x est la dernière à prendre en charge Python 3.8 et 3.9.

La note de version complète de Django 5.0 est ici.

Django est un logiciel libre sous licence BSD, disponible sur GitHub.